Dual-comb spectroscopy is an attractive tool for high-speed, high-resolution, and broadband spectroscopy.
However, based on two mode-locked lasers and a complex servo system with an auxiliary CW laser,
the prohibitive cost of a conventional dual-comb laser system prevents further applicability in broad
fields. To overcome this problem, we develop a dual-comb fiber laser that simultaneously generates two
high-coherence ultra-broadband frequency combs with slightly different repetition rates.
